Narrative and Notes

In 1841 Isaac was living with his third wife Elizabeth and his son-in-law Joseph SMITH. This son-in-law was 17 meaning that he was born in 1834. It suggest that Elizabeth was the widow of someone called SMITH with at least one child, Joseph born 1834.

4 - UK 1841 Census - 7th June 1841

Note: Ages of adults were often rounded down to nearest 5 years. For example, a recorded age of 25 implies an age of between 25 and 29.
